Output f5d4eb67ad83342808becda14ab82d933af2500088442ba82bc21245f13f9e55:2

value
18250463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813ebd0ae660d9f9804ef3a8e1189950158e9150 OP_EQUAL
address
3DUQFS71F6rcuHgpUybJhGReVfUzZJ5VpN
transaction
f5d4eb67ad83342808becda14ab82d933af2500088442ba82bc21245f13f9e55
spent
true